Been listening to "Blizzard of Ozz" a bunch lately. Sure Randy Rhoads was a beast and Ozzy was at the top of his game, but Bob Daisely was laying it down on bass! Love his chunky tone, especially on "Mr. Crowley" and "I Don't Know".

I read up on him on Wikipedia...pretty interesting stuff. Looks like he and the original drummer got hosed by Ozzy and replaced by Sarzo and Aldridge.
